(Friday, November 20, 1925) — Robert Francis Kennedy, American politician who served as U.S. Attorney General under his brother, President John F. Kennedy, and later as a U.S. Senator for New York, before being assassinated while campaigning for the Democratic nomination for U.S. president, was born today outside Boston in Brookline, Massachusetts.
